🥘 Ingredients

9 items
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 0.5 cups gran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on baking powder
  • 0.5 teaspoons salt
  • 1 cups milk (or any dairy-free alternative)
  • 0.25 cups neutral oil (such as vegetable or canola oil)
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 cup optional mix-ins (like chocolate chips, nuts, dried fruit, or spices)

📝 Instructions

9 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and lightly grease a 9x5-inch loaf pan or line it with parchment paper for easy removal.

2

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, granulated sugar, baking powder, and salt.

3

In a separate bowl, whisk the milk, neutral oil, egg, and vanilla extract until well combined.

4

Gradually p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ients, mixing until just combined. Be careful not to overmix, as this can make the bread dense.

5

If using optional mix-ins, gently fold them into the batter until evenly distributed.

6

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an, spreading it evenly with a spatula.

7

Bake in the preheated oven for 50-55 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.

8

Remove the bread from the oven and allow it to cool in the pan for 10-15 minutes. Then trans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ely before slicing and serving.

9

Enjoy! Wrap leftovers tightly in plastic wrap or store in an airtight container for up to 3 days at room temperature or up to a week in the refrigerator.
